The Atlantic tells the story of Nicholas Gilbert, a farmer in upstate New York, near the Canadian border. He had just gotten a shipment of livestock feed with a $2,200 tariff surcharge attached.
Gilbert cannot increase the price of the milk he sells, which is set by the local co-op. He cannot feed his cows less food. He cannot buy feed from another supplier; there arent any nearby, and getting it from farther away would be more expensive. When he got the delivery, he stared at the tariff for a while. Shouldnt his Canadian supplier have been responsible for paying it?
Im not even sure its legal! We contracted for the price on delivery! If your price of fuel goes up or your truck breaks down, thats not my problem! Thats what the contracts for.
